Overview
The TLV6003DBVR is a single ultra-low power operational amplifier manufactured by Texas Instruments. This device is known for its precision and rail-to-rail input and output capabilities, making it highly versatile for various applications. It operates with an extremely low quiescent current of 980 nA and supports a wide voltage range of up to 16 V. The TLV6003DBVR is packaged in a compact SOT-23 (DBV) package with 5 pins, making it suitable for space-constrained designs.
Key Specifications
Parameter | Value |
---|---|
Quiescent Current | 980 nA |
Input Voltage Range | Rail-to-Rail |
Output Voltage Range | Rail-to-Rail |
Maximum Operating Voltage | 16 V |
Package Type | SOT-23 (DBV) |
Number of Pins | 5 |
